  • Lottie Leefe - Founder and Director of DURA Private, & Wealth Planner
    May 7 2021

    Lottie Leefe the Founder and Director of DURA Private, and qualified Wealth Planner who assists U/HNWI, as well as Next Gen wealth, on their global assets and investments including art, real estate, wine, luxury goods and philanthropy. She also provides a sophisticated level of coaching to her clients on a one-on-one basis.

    Lottie's work with The Dura Society has enabled her to present finance to a wider and non-traditional audience, working with the likes of Soho House, Condé Nast International, BlackRock and PitchBook.

    Lottie is a member of the Financial Therapy Association, the Personal Financial Society and is an ambassador for Insuring Women’s Futures through the Chartered Insurance Institute.

    In this episode, Lottie discusses the role of financial wellbeing, especially in relation to women (e.g. Women's Pension Deficit), shares her self-care habits and exceptional good nature and humour.

  • Priyanka Dubey - Writer, Reporter and Author of 'No Nation for Women'
    Feb 7 2021

    Priyanka Dubey is a Writer, Journalist and Bilingual Correspondent.

    She is the published author of the investigative book: ‘No Nation For Women - Reportage on Rape from India, the World’s Largest Democracy’ and an absolute pleasure to speak with. Her first-hand experience with women in India and documentation of their intricate (and often troubled) stories, offer extraordinary depth into the situation of gender inequality experienced by women in India. 

     

    Priyanka discusses the role of Indian women, the vital importance of self-care, and highlights her own experience as an award-winning journalist.

  • Polly Swann - British Olympic Rower & Junior Doctor 
    Jan 19 2021

    Polly Swann is an Edinburgh born, Olympic British Rower, and Junior Doctor! 

    She became an Olympic silver medallist as part of the women’s eight, at the Rio 2016 Olympic Games, and was crowned the World and European Champion, during her GB Rowing Team career.

    At the beginning of the Covid-19 Pandemic in 2020, Polly took time off from her training, to work for 3 months as an interim foundation year doctor at her local hospital in Scotland. Polly is no stranger to managing her time (exceptionally well) around both of her incredible pursuits. In 2019, after taking a short career break to complete her medical degree, Polly returned to the GB squad and won a bronze medal in the women’s pair alongside Holly Hill.

    In episode 4 of Women Who Self Care, Polly talks to Boo about women in sports (offering tips to those who want to start exercising, or even to go pro!), as well discussing the role of women within society. Polly explains how she initially started rowing and highlights how she organised her time between being an Olympian and a Medical Student (she also studied some modules in Global Health Policy at the University of London!).

  • Emily Cox - Co-founder & Creative Director of Design Studio Stories Studios
    Dec 20 2020

    Emily Cox, Co-founder & Creative Director of Stories Studios, moved from the rainy isles of the UK to Ibiza, to set up her own Design Studio with co-founder Melissa Harris, by setting up a pretend campaign: taking pictures of jewellery from MANGO and sending the photos off to brands...before now co-running her company and team in the beautiful old town of Barcelona.

    Emily talks about being a Creative Director at the age of 26, the importance of working with ethical brands, being supremely self-confident and what self-care rituals and routines she does to maintain her dreamy creative Barcelona life.

  • Charlotte Kneer - CEO of RBWA, Public Speaker & Campaigner for Victims of Domestic Abuse
    Nov 20 2020

    Charlotte Kneer

    Charlotte Kneer, the CEO of the Reigate and Banstead Women’s Aid, is a survivor of domestic abuse who now helps other women to escape their abuser and live lives free from harm. Charlotte shares her personal experience, whilst highlighting what the red flags of domestic abuse are and how to break-free. With such emotionally taxing work, Charlotte tells WWSC how she #selfcares and how working in an all-female environment is truly liberating.

  • Anna Lawson - Kona Triathlete, Engineer and Climate Change Educator
    Nov 8 2020

    Anna Lawson, Chemical Engineer and Energy Consultant, has competed in the Ironman Kona World Championships, twice! Anna talks about how she trains for a triathlon, the role of women in today’s society and how she #selfcares around training, work and helping to run the Climate Cocktail Club.
